Output ecf0e5aaa0692021b5dd6fb83ac5e31c9c72dc5c0acf688a939a5dbce155e225:0

value
26340304
script pubkey
OP_0 OP_PUSHBYTES_20 8616e13f197116d6b20a3543e30c1b1672f55253
address
bc1qsctwz0cewytddvs2x4p7xrqmzee025jnw6n8ka
transaction
ecf0e5aaa0692021b5dd6fb83ac5e31c9c72dc5c0acf688a939a5dbce155e225
confirmations
125816
spent
true